Firefighters in Hong Kong have been nonetheless battling an enormous blaze on Thursday after a lethal fireplace tore by means of a high-rise housing property, killing at the least 44 folks and leaving a whole bunch lacking.The catastrophe, monetary hub’s worst fireplace in many years, erupted all of a sudden on Wednesday afternoon (native time) and quickly consumed elements of the densely packed Wang Fuk Court docket complicated in Tai Po.
What led to tragedy
The chain of occasions began round 2:50pm on Wednesday, when flames first broke out on the eight-building property, house to about 2,000 models throughout 32-storey towers. The reason for the fireplace was not instantly recognized, however the buildings have been beneath restore and wrapped in bamboo scaffolding — a standard and flammable materials nonetheless generally utilized in Hong Kong.Authorities had beforehand warned concerning the hazard of bamboo scaffolding after one other blaze unfold quickly final October. Regardless of authorities plans to section it out in favour of fire-resistant metal, the Wang Fuk Court docket property remained coated in bamboo.By early Thursday, police had arrested three males, saying flammable supplies left behind throughout upkeep work had allowed the blaze “to unfold quickly past management”.

Rising casualties, mounting chaos
By Thursday morning, officers confirmed 44 deaths, together with a 37-year-old firefighter who was found with burns after dropping contact with colleagues for about half an hour, fireplace service director Andy Yeung stated.Earlier, Hong Kong chief John Lee stated 279 folks have been unaccounted for, although firefighters later reached a few of them. Greater than 900 residents took shelter in short-term services.At these shelters, cops struggled to find out an actual depend of the lacking as residents continued arriving late into the night time to report lacking members of the family.The hazard was nonetheless seen within the property as charred scaffolding collapsed, flames burst from home windows and a fiery orange glow illuminated close by buildings. Residents have been evacuated by coach, and native media reported that adjoining blocks have been being cleared. Components of a close-by freeway have been additionally shut down for the firefighting operation.
